Barraters

/bəˈreɪtərz/ noun

Definition

Plural form of barrater; multiple people who commit barratry or maritime fraud.

Etymology

English plural of barrater, preserving the legal/maritime terminology. Multiple perpetrators of the same crime of maritime fraud.
